MasterChef Australia Season 1 Episode 20 : Julia and the Duck hd
videy.press
45% Complete
00:00:00 / 01:15:26

Watch MasterChef Australia Season 1 Episode 20 : Julia and the Duck Full Series Streaming

  Free Download MasterChef Australia Season 1 Episode 20 : Julia and the Duck 720p 6,647 Kb/s
  HD - MasterChef Australia Season 1 Episode 20 : Julia and the Duck HD 4,184 Kb/s
  MasterChef Australia Season 1 Episode 20 : Julia and the Duck Full Full HD 7,993 Kb/s